Ordinance 18707

Introduced as Council Bill 5538

Title

An Ordinance providing for the improvement of Lot 1, Block 34, Lots 1, 2, 3, 4 and that part of Lot 8 lying east of railway right of way in Block 36, Lots 2, 5, 6, 7 and 8 in Block 37, that part of Lot 6 lying each of railway right of way in Block 38, Lots 1, 2, that part of Lot 3 lying east of railway right of way, that part of lot 4 lying east of railway right of way, that part of lot 4 lying west or railway right of way, Lots 5, 6 and 7 all in Block 39, and the North 1/2 of Lot 2 in Block 40 all in Maynard's Plat of the Town (now City) of Seattle; that part of Lots 1, 2, 3, 4 and 5 lying east of the railway right of way, that part of lot 6 lying west of railway right of way all in Block 4, Lots 5 and 6 and that part of Lots 7 and 8 lying east of railway of way, that part of Lots 7 and 8 lying west of railway right of way, all in Block 5, Lot 2 Block 2 and in Plummer's Addition to the City of Seattle; Lots 2, 5, 6 and 7 Block 203, that part of Lots 1 and 6 lying west of railway right of way, Lots 2, 3, 4, 7, 8, 9, and 10 all in Block 213, Lots 1, 2, 7 and 8 including 1/2 vacated alley adjoining same in Block 209, Lots 2 and 3, also Lots 1 and 4 including 1/2 vacated alley adjoining same all in Block 204, South 39.94' of Lot 1, North 20' of Lot 1, Lots 2, 3, 4, 6 and 8, North 57' of Lot 5, South 3' of Lot 5, North 15' of Lot 7 and South 45' of Lot 7 all in Block 206, Lots 1 and 2 in Block 207, Lot 7 Block 208, Lots 1, 2, 3, 4, 7, 8, 9, 5, North 40' of Lot 6, South 10' of Lot 6, all including 1/2 vacated alley adjoining same, all in Block 210, Lots 1, 2 and 3 including 1/2 vacated street adjoining same all Block 211, Lots 1, 2, 3 and 4 exception railway right of way but including 1/2 of vacated street and also 1/2 of vacated alley adjoining same, Lots 5, 6 and 7 including 1/2 vacated alley adjoining same, Lot 8 including 1/2 of vacated alley adjoining same and excluding railway right of way all in Block 214, Lots 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 7, 8, North 20' of Lot 6, South 40' of Lot 6 including 1/2 vacated alley adjoining same all in Block 215, North 30', of Lot 1, South 30' of Lot 1, Lots 2, 3 and 4 all in Block 216 all of Seattle Tide Lands; Lots 3, 5 and that part of Lot 4 West of the railway right of way, in Block 9, Lots 5, 6 and 7 in Block 8, all in Terry's Fifth Addition to the City of Seattle, by filling the same, and by erecting bulkheads and retaining walls thereon wherever necessary, as a sanitary measure, and fixing and establishing grades thereof, all in accordance with Resolution No. 1200 and 1295 of the City Council of the City of Seattle, and providing for the payment therefor by the mode of "Payment by Bonds," as provided by the laws of the State of Washington and the Charter and Ordinances of the City of Seattle, and declaring an emergency.

Legislative History

Date Introduced:May 18, 1908
City Council Action Date:June 22, 1908
City Council Action:Passed
Date Delivered to Mayor:June 23, 1908
Date Signed by Mayor:
(About the signature date)
June 27, 1908
Date Filed with Clerk:June 27, 1908
